Reinforcement steel is a critical structural material in RCC columns, beams, slabs, footings, retaining walls, staircases, shear walls and other building components. Its performance directly influences tensile resistance, crack control, ductility, seismic behaviour and long-term structural durability. Poor-quality reinforcement can lead to corrosion, reduced bond strength, excessive elongation, structural cracks and premature failure, compromising the safety of the entire structure. 📌 Key Tests Covered in the Building Reinforcement QC Excel
✔ Mechanical Properties
• Yield Strength
• Ultimate Tensile Strength
• Percentage Elongation
✔ Chemical Composition Test
• Carbon
• Sulphur
• Phosphorus
✔ Mass & Dimension Test
• Nominal Diameter Verification
• Weight per Meter
• Dimensional Tolerance Checks
These tests help determine whether reinforcement steel complies with the structural design requirements and site acceptance criteria.
